I would like to see a way, possibly via the system menu, of changing the video or audio decoder on-the-fly. I haven't found one pair that meets all my HD/SD sports and quality requirements. The current process is very time consuming and since it really is client only code, it unnecessarily (config.xml aside) causes the record service to restart, killing running recordings and disconnecting all mvp clients.

I would still like to see the power on/startup default stored via config.exe,

The old app used to support this via the System -> Settings screen. I havnt had time to replace this screen yet in PVRX2, but it'll retain the same feature.

Are you finding you're using one decoder for HD, and another for SD? Unfortunately I usually dont know which of these its going to be by the time playback starts (or what channels the user will later change to), otherwise I could have looked to add an HD / SD decoder setting.

For full screen I've found that if it work for HD it works for SD but there are caveats

- for SD sports in a small window I have terrible problems with tearing that I don't see even in HD windowed. The MainConcept 1.0 works best for me but I find its not as good quality wise as I enlarge the screen. However if I want full screen SD I typically use the mvp anyway. The MPV decoder seems to provide nice quality for everything but sports where it makes me feel nauseous even at full screen.

- for HD the issue is more a/v sync and testing going through the permutations of decoders is a pain. I think I've got it now, but I'm not sure I've got the perfect combination. 1080i seems pretty good on several decoders. a/v sync isn't an issue for me at SD.

One thing that really has helped with my HVR 1600 is the new signal strength tool since I know when the signal is best. Before there were too many elements involved and I never got to tune for quality.
